Riders’ playoffs end in heartbreak, fall 23-18 to Bombers
Don’t blame the referees.
That’s the message that offensive lineman Thaddeus Coleman had at the end of the west semi-final Sunday night.
The Roughriders fell 23-18 to the Blue Bombers in a snow game at Mosaic Stadium, but the ending was marred when Brandon Bridge took a vicious hit to the head on the second last play of the game.
The hit by Bombers defensive lineman Jackson Jeffcoat crumpled the starting pivot who was in the game because Zach Collaros was not feeling right after he took a head shot at the end of the season – a call that was also missed by CFL referees.
